Minority shareholder One Equity Partners agrees to become the sole owner of carbon black producer Co-lumbian Chemicals Co. by buying out DC Chemical Co. Ltd.'s interest.
Goldsmith & Eggleton Inc. renovates its black masterbatch and reprocessed polymers mill room and installs mills at its Wadsworth, Ohio, operation to expand capacity.
Carbon black maker Cabot Corp. decides to close four plants and a regional office and mothball two other facilities.
Custom mixer Pinnacle Elastomeric Technology doubles its production space.
Oregon Mills plans to expand its custom mixing capacity by 30 percent at a plant in Corvallis, Ore.
Thermoplastic material compounder RTP Co. upgrades its production capabilities and adds a quality assurance lab to its Winona, Minn., facility.
Rubber equipment maker and rebuilder Gomaplast Machinery Inc. acquires a building and land to more than double its operating space in Wooster, Ohio.
U.S. Molding Machinery Co. buys a mold and tool shop near its Willoughby, Ohio, operation.
Guill Tool & Engineering Inc. expands its capacity by 20 percent via the addition of equipment at its West Warwick, R.I., facility.
Green Rubber Inc. plans to raise $25 million in capital to finance an expansion of its scrap rubber devulcanization in the U.S. and several other countries.
Engel Holding GmbH's North American operation opens a technical center in Corona, Calif., and breaks ground for another one in Queretaro, Mexico.
Production is suspended at the Monongahela, Pa., plant of Flexsys Americas for several months.
DuPont Performance Elastomers decides to quit making Hypalon and Acsium chlorosulfonated polyethylenes and close its Beaumont, Texas, plant.
Pathway Polymers Inc. sells its Puma Polymers Division to two executives of the firm.
A management group buys Biltrite Rubber (1984) Inc.'s Toronto custom mixing plant.
Dow Chemical Co. puts its newly formed Styron Corp. subsidiary, which includes SBR and SB-latex holdings, on the selling block.
The Bekaert S.A. bead wire plant in Clarksdale, Miss., gets a closure notice, resulting in 76 layoffs.
Dow Chemical opens a laboratory for the elastomer business at its Freeport, Texas, research and development facility.
Kraton Polymers L.L.C. opens an innovation center in Houston, and later declares it will launch an initial public offering at an undetermined date.
A leak of polyurethane curative toluene diisocyanate at Dow Chemical's plant in Freeport, Texas, caused an evacuation of 65 homes.
DuPont Protection Technologies plans to build a Kevlar production facility in Charleston, S.C.
Robbins L.L.C. buys Biltrite Group's Findlay, Ohio, custom mixing and calendering operation.
